首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>使用选择性表截断实现SQL Server迁移的自动化

使用选择性表截断实现SQL Server迁移的自动化
EN

Stack Overflow用户
提问于 2018-05-01 07:59:03
回答 1查看 62关注 0票数 0

我想知道是否有SQL Server专家有任何技巧可以帮助我使用迁移助手和选择性Drop+Create SQL脚本测试到SQL Server的MS访问端口。

我有一个新的SQL Server数据库,我正在从总共5个外部MS-Access数据库迁移该数据库。一个数据库每天都会更改,我希望每隔一段时间就用新数据更新我的测试SQL Server

我现在的问题是,我不想删除+创建整个数据库。我只想有选择地从一个MS-Access数据库中删除要迁移的表。

我在SQL Server中看不到这样的选项。我是否遗漏了什么工具或菜单项?

我使用的是SQL Server 13.0 (2017),并且有SQL Server 2016导入/导出向导

EN

回答 1

Stack Overflow用户

发布于 2018-05-01 16:23:10

不确定我是不是漏掉了什么。

创建在运行导入之前运行的SQL脚本。

代码语言:javascript
复制
-- Drop all tables imported from Access database x
DROP TABLE foo;
DROP TABLE bar;
-- etc
GO

要避免键入所有表名,请参见例如list of tables without indexes in sql 2008

或者在源数据库中使用MSysObjects

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/50109761

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档